Ingredients List

To create these irresistible Buttery S’Mores Hand Pies, gather the following ingredients:

For the Hand Pies:

  • 1 package refrigerated pie crusts (2 crusts): A time-saver that provides a flaky base.
  • 1 cup chocolate chips: Semi-sweet or milk chocolate for that classic s’mores flavor.
  • 1 cup mini marshmallows: Adds that gooey texture.
  • ½ cup graham cracker crumbs: For that authentic s’mores crunch.
  • 1 egg (beaten): For egg wash, giving the pies a golden finish.
  • 1 tablespoon sugar: For sprinkling on top for added sweetness.

Optional Substitutions:

  • Gluten-free pie crusts: For a gluten-free option.
  • Dark chocolate chips: For a richer flavor.
  • Nut butter: Add a layer of peanut or almond butter for a unique twist.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). This temperature is ideal for achieving a perfectly golden crust.

Step 2: Prepare the Filling

In a mixing bowl, combine chocolate chips, mini marshmallows, and graham cracker crumbs. Stir until well mixed. This filling is the heart of your hand pies, providing the classic s’mores flavor.

Step 3: Roll Out the Pie Crust

Unroll the refrigerated pie crusts on a lightly floured surface. Use a round cutter (about 4-5 inches in diameter) to cut out circles from the dough. You should be able to get about 8-10 circles, depending on how thin you roll the dough.

Step 4: Assemble the Hand Pies

Place a tablespoon of the filling mixture in the center of each dough circle. Be careful not to overfill, as this can cause the pies to burst during baking. Fold the dough over to create a half-moon shape and press the edges together to seal. Use a fork to crimp the edges for a decorative touch and to ensure they’re well sealed.

Step 5: Brush and Sprinkle

Transfer the hand pies to a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Brush the tops with the beaten egg and sprinkle with sugar for a sweet, crunchy finish.

Step 6: Bake the Pies

Bake in the preheated oven for 20 minutes, or until the pies are golden brown. Keep an eye on them to prevent over-baking.

Step 7: Cool and Serve

Once baked, remove the pies from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ving. They’re best enjoyed warm, with the chocolate still gooey!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overfilling the Pies: Too much filling can cause the pies to burst; stick to about a tablespoon.
  • Not Sealing Properly: Ensure the edges are well crimped to prevent leakage during baking.
  • Skipping the Egg Wash: This step is crucial for achieving a golden, glossy finish on your hand pies.

Storing Tips for the Recipe

  • Refrigeration: Store leftover hand pies in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
  • Freezing: These hand pies freeze well! Freeze unbaked hand pies on a baking sheet, then transfer to a freezer bag for up to 2 months. Bake directly from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the baking time.
  • Reheating: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es to restore crispiness.

FAQs

Can I make these hand pies in advance?

Yes! You can prepare the hand pies and freeze them before baking. Bake them directly from frozen when you’re ready to serve.

What can I substitute for chocolate chips?

You can use any type of chocolate chips, including dark chocolate or white chocolate, based on your preference.

Can I use homemade pie crust instead of refrigerated?

Absolutely! If you have a favorite homemade pie crust recipe, feel free to use it for a more personalized touch.
